Why tinnitus is a real risk at concerts
Sound levels at concerts frequently exceed 100 decibels. Even short exposure can stress the delicate structures in your inner ear. Many people notice temporary ringing after a show—but repeated exposure increases the risk of permanent tinnitus and hearing damage.
This makes hearing protection at concerts essential, not optional.
How concert earplugs protect without ruining the music
Modern music earplugs for concerts are designed to lower harmful sound levels without distorting the music. Instead of blocking everything, they reduce the damaging frequencies and overall volume, while letting the natural sound of vocals and instruments come through clearly.
This means you can:
- Hear the music as it’s meant to sound
- Reduce harsh, sharp frequencies
- Avoid the “muffled” feeling of basic earplugs
The goal is simple: keep the good sound in and the damaging noise out.

Choose the right earplugs for concerts
Look for reusable earplugs for concerts that offer:
- Even sound reduction (not muffling)
- Comfortable fit for long wear
- Certified noise reduction (dB rating)
